Pot Noodle: Success doesn't come on a plate
The challenge
Pot Noodle's association with 1990s 'Slacker' culture had always made it the choice of the lazy and the indolent, but today's 16-24 year-olds no longer identified with that lifestyle. They were driven, ambitious and determined to succeed.
Pot Noodle was becoming a cultural pariah and as a result, its sales and market share were dropping. Something radical had to be done.
